Radan Kanev: There is a group in society that sees the status quo as stability. She supports GERB and DPS

"Sarafov's deputy is naturally a concern for us. It is not the job of the Ministry of Justice to carry out judicial reform," the MEP also commented

" Sarafov's deputy is naturally a concern for us. It is not the job of the Ministry of Justice to do judicial reform. This Parliament has the opportunity to pass the Judiciary Act. Bulgarian citizens, not the acting Minister of Justice, are the ones who must say on June 9 whether they want the judicial reform to be accelerated. Do they want an independent body to investigate corruption or not. We have not seen a real working anti-corruption system like Romania had."

This opinion was expressed on the air of BNT by MEP Radan Kanev in connection with the project cabinet announced by Dimitar Glavchev, quoted by frognews.bg.

"Since the main function of the official cabinet is to hold fair elections, it is logical to look to the Ministry of Internal Affairs, because it has a fundamental role in conducting them. Bulgarian history has clearly shown that when Bulgarians have clear goals, no MIA, no money, can have a negative impact. My hope is that the Bulgarian citizens will clearly say that they want to continue the course of reforms and changes. The MIA is important with very low voter turnout," the politician believes.

"There is a group in society that sees the status quo as stability. It quite legitimately supports GERB and DPS, as an expression of their interest. There is clearly a large group of Bulgarian citizens who want quick reforms. There is also a third opposition group, which sincerely wishes Bulgaria to part with its European membership, with the development of the market economy, and which is looking for its temporary refuge. These people want to return to the arms of the Kremlin", warns the MEP.

Kanev pointed out that Dimitar Glavchev is nominated by GERB, which should not surprise us. According to him, we are Bulgarian citizens and we are not obliged to like the composition of the draft cabinet.

"My reservations are as follows: In the Ministry of Economy - Mr. Petko Nikolov. He is a man with a very long history. His next appointment to a key post in the state was met with disappointment. I react with concern and questioning what task the new Minister of Economy has to fulfill in the coming months. The other thing is that we see some worrying processes in the Ministry of Energy. Mr. Malinov is a controversial person. The caretaker government of Mr. Donev has prepared a plan in which 300 out of 400 million are directed to new gas projects. The EC reflected on us, and at this stage, Bulgaria has lost 300 million, because of the attempts to be tied to eastern suppliers", he also said.
